Man Utd vs Tottenham – Europa League final LIVE RESULT: Scrappy Johnson goal gives Spurs first trophy in 17 years
{by} thesun

TOTTENHAM have defeated Manchester United 1-0 in the Europa League final in Bilbao!

Spurs may have endured a woeful season in the league - but they've ended it with Champions League qualification after winning the final.

Brennan Johnson bundled the ball home to score the only goal of the game as Tottenham fans went wild in the San Mames Stadium.

Man Utd boss Ruben Amorim gave a strong answer when asked about next season.

He said: "I will not quit.

"I am confident in my job and I will not change anything.

"If the board or fans feel that I’m not the right guy, I will go the next day without any conversation about compensation."

Club captain Son Heung-min was all smiles as he appeared on TNT Sports and said: ""Let's say I'm a legend. why not? Only today!

"17 years nobody has done it, so today let's say with amazing players probably a legend of the club.

"This is what I've always dreamed for. Today is the day it happened. I am the happiest man in the world.

"When you look at the whole season there will always be some situation you have a tough time but we as players always stuck together.

"I felt the pressure. I wanted it so badly. The last seven days I was dreaming about this game every night. It finally happened and I can sleep easy now!

"We can celebrate today so let's just make it one we will never forget and maybe I will miss the flight tomorrow!"

With Tottenham having a slender lead in the game, a superb acrobatic clearance from van de Ven saw him deny Man Utd an equaliser.

After Vicario's error, the Dutchman did brilliantly to hook it off the goal line.

If he wasn't one before, the defender will be a hero with fans forever after ensuring they scooped the trophy tonight in Bilbao.

Speaking with TNT Sports, the Spurs' manager gave his views after this massive moment:

Look I am still taking it all in. I know what it means for this football club. Unfortunately the longer it goes on, it is harder to break that cycle. There are supporters who have been following us for those 41 years and not seen it. I felt we were going to be hard to break down. I just had this thing inside me, I know our league form has been terrible, I knew only us winning something would change our mentality.

Man Utd icon Rio Ferdinand told TNT Sports: "A disaster of a season ending on a bad note, but I don't think Man Utd did enough to deserve it.

"There was no real cutting edge in the Man Utd team. All that sustained pressure, the goalkeeper [Guglielmo Vicario] made one save in the whole game - you can't expect to win a trophy when you're a bit reserved."

He added: Getting those defenders back was critical for [Tottenham].

"Cristian Romero and Micky van de Ven wanted to defend that penalty area.

"They were not bothered about Harry Maguire being up - they enjoyed the battle.

"They defended for their lives and they got what they needed."

So after all the talk of El Crapico we got.... that.

Certainly not a Clasico, with little class on show.

You can't take anything away from Spurs, they sat deep, did what they had to do and will be wondering why it's taken 17 years to win a trophy when it was that easy tonight.

Fair play to Ange for ditching Ange Ball. It must take a lot of humility to ditch a tactic named after you. But it worked.

And whatever Amorim had told his players to do, didn't.

They only really raised the tempo in the dying minutes, with Vicario only making his first save after 75 minutes.

No one should be surprised United served up such dross, it's what they've been best at all season.

As for Spurs, dare I say it but, bar Vicario's attempts to let United back in, that was an unSpursy second half.

Congratulations to them, and if this is the end of Ange's time in charge, what a way to go out.

The goalscorer, draped in a Wales flag at the end of the match, added: "[The final few minutes were] horrible. I couldn't watch.

"I was listening to what the boys were saying, asking how long was left.

"When we defended that corner at the end, I kind of knew. The relief is nothing I can describe.

"Tottenham Hotspur finishing 17th in the Premier League isn't good enough, but we've had an unbelievable Europa run and the fans have been so good.

"I thought they had the edge on the United fans, to be honest... it got us through the game.

"He [Postecoglou] has done his job. If there's ever a time for a mic drop, it's now so I'll be looking forward to his interview.

"I can't thank the manager enough for how much trust he's had in us... especially in the Europa League, he had a great way of getting everyone up for it and it shows."

Matchwinner Brennan Johnson was absolutely BUZZING when he was interviewed by TNT Sports.

He said: "I'm so happy right now. This season hasn't been good, but not one of us players cares right now.

"This is what it's all about... it means so much.

"All the fans get battered, we get battered for not winning a trophy, but to get the first one in a while today, I'm so happy.

"Ever since I came here, it's been 'Tottenham are a good team but never get it done'. We got it done.

"I knew I touched it [for the goal] and then I looked up and the ball was trickling into the goal.

"I can't describe the feeling."
